

Born in Caguas, Puerto Rico and grew up in Lynn. He was a graduate of Lynn Classical High School and Rhode Island College where he earned his Bachelor’s Degree in Social Services. He began his career as a social worker in Rhode Island and later retired while working in Brockton.
In addition to his mother, Fernando is survived by his brother Miguel Reyes and his wife Jennifer, his nieces Amanda Reyes and her husband Brian Crounse of Gloucester, Stephanie Herzig and her husband Ian of Malden, and Monica Gagliardi and her husband Joseph and their children Lily, Pia and Anthony of Cheshire, CT. He is also survived by his beloved dog Max.
